Regularly Assess Backup Needs

To ensure effective backup solutions, it's essential to regularly assess your organization's backup needs. This helps identify any gaps or changes in data protection requirements. According to a survey by the Ponemon Institute, 60% of organizations experienced data loss due to inadequate backup procedures. Regularly assessing backup needs can improve data security and reduce the risk of data loss.

Mistake to avoid: Neglecting to reassess backup needs can lead to outdated and ineffective backup strategies.

Actionable tip: Conduct a comprehensive backup assessment every six months to identify areas for improvement.

Real-life example: A security system administrator regularly evaluates backup needs as new systems and technologies are introduced to the organization.

Takeaway: Regularly assessing backup needs ensures that backup solutions remain effective and up-to-date.

Implement Multi-Factor Authentication for Backup Access

Using multi-factor authentication for backup access is a crucial step in enhancing security. It significantly reduces the risk of unauthorized access to critical backup data. According to a report by Verizon, 80% of hacking-related breaches involve compromised or weak passwords. By implementing multi-factor authentication, security system administrators can enhance protection against unauthorized data breaches.

Mistake to avoid: Relying solely on passwords for backup access can lead to vulnerabilities.

Actionable tip: Implement multi-factor authentication, combining passwords with additional verification factors such as biometrics or SMS codes.

Real-life example: By implementing multi-factor authentication, a security system administrator prevents unauthorized individuals from accessing and tampering with backup data.

Takeaway: Multi-factor authentication provides an extra layer of security to safeguard backup solutions.

Establish a Comprehensive Backup Schedule

Creating a comprehensive backup schedule is essential for ensuring data availability and minimizing downtime. It helps ensure regular and consistent backups, reducing the risk of data loss. According to a study by the National Archives and Records Administration, 93% of companies that experienced data loss and downtime for more than ten days filed for bankruptcy within a year. A comprehensive backup schedule reduces downtime and minimizes the impact on business operations in case of a data loss event.

Mistake to avoid: Failing to establish a regular backup schedule can result in incomplete or outdated backups.

Actionable tip: Create a backup schedule that includes automated backups at regular intervals, taking into account the organization's data volume and criticality.

Real-life example: A security system administrator sets up automated backups to run every night, ensuring data is consistently protected.

Takeaway: A comprehensive backup schedule is crucial to minimize data loss and potential business disruptions.

Implement Offsite Data Storage for Redundancy

Implementing offsite data storage provides an added layer of redundancy and protection for backup solutions. It safeguards against physical damage or loss of backup data at the primary location. According to a report by Statista, 22% of data loss incidents are caused by natural disasters. Offsite data storage reduces the risk of complete data loss in case of on-premises infrastructure failure or disasters.

Mistake to avoid: Relying solely on on-site backup storage can expose the organization to significant data loss and prolonged downtime.

Actionable tip: Utilize cloud storage or establish an offsite backup location to store critical data backups securely.

Real-life example: A security system administrator regularly replicates backups to an offsite data center to ensure data resilience in case of a disaster.

Takeaway: Offsite data storage adds an extra layer of protection and resilience to backup solutions.

Regularly Test Backup Restoration Processes

Regularly testing backup restoration processes is vital to ensure the reliability and effectiveness of backup solutions. It verifies the ability to restore backups and identifies any issues before they become critical. Research from the Disaster Recovery Preparedness Council suggests that 30% of organizations never test their backups. Regular testing increases confidence in the ability to recover data in case of a real data loss incident.

Mistake to avoid: Neglecting to test backup restoration processes can result in failed recovery attempts and data loss.

Actionable tip: Conduct regular and systematic tests of backup restoration processes to validate their reliability.

Real-life example: A security system administrator performs scheduled tests to restore backups to a test environment to ensure their integrity and usability.

Takeaway: Regular testing of backup restoration processes is essential to ensure their effectiveness and avoid unexpected data loss.

Encrypt Backup Data for Enhanced Security

Encrypting backup data adds an extra layer of security and safeguards sensitive information. It protects against unauthorized access to backup data, even if the storage media is compromised. In a study by the Morning Consult, 60% of IT decision-makers reported concerns about the security of their backup data. Encryption of backup data provides an additional layer of security to prevent unauthorized access.

Mistake to avoid: Neglecting to encrypt backup data leaves it vulnerable to theft or unauthorized exposure.

Actionable tip: Utilize encryption technologies to secure backup data, both at rest and during transit.

Real-life example: A security system administrator enables backup data encryption, ensuring that even if external hard drives are lost or stolen, the data remains protected.

Takeaway: Encryption of backup data provides an additional layer of security to prevent unauthorized access.
